Season 9 of GO Battle League lasted from August 30th, 2021 to November 29th, 2021.[1] It is preceded by Season 8 and succeeded by Season 10. This GO Battle League Season ran concurrently with Season of Mischief.

In this Season, Little Jungle Cup was introduced. GO Battle Night has become GO Battle Day to allow more Trainers participating.

Great League Remix: 1,500 CP limit. Top 20 Pokémon banned.

Ultra League Remix: 2,500 CP limit. Top 10 Pokémon banned.

Little Jungle Cup: 500 CP limit. Only Normal-, Grass-, Electric-, Poison-, Ground-, Flying-, Bug-, and Dark-types allowed. Shuckle and Smeargle banned.

Halloween Cup: Only Poison-, Ghost-, Bug-, Dark-, and Fairy-type Pokémon allowed, excluding Legendary and Mythical ones. 1,500 CP limit.

Kanto Cup: Only Pokémon with a Pokédex number between #001 and #151 allowed. 1,500 CP limit.

GO Battle Days[]

September 18th, 2021[]

The first GO Battle Day took place on September 18th, 2021 from 12 a.m. to 11:59 p.m. local time. Ultra League and Ultra League Remix were available during this GO Battle Day.

November 1st, 2021[]

GO Battle Day took place on November 1st, 2021 from 12 a.m. to 11:59 p.m. local time. Ultra League and Ultra Premier Classic and Halloween Cup were available during this GO Battle Day.

November 20th, 2021[]

GO Battle Day took place on November 20th, 2021 from 12 p.m. to 11:59 p.m. local time. Master League, Master Premier Classic and Kanto Cup were available during this GO Battle Day.

Attack updates[]

These Attack updates went live at the start of the Season:

Attack changes[]

  • Weather Ball: Base power was reduced from 60 to 55 in Trainer Battles and Gym and Raid Battles.
  • Crunch: 30% chance to lower the opponent's Defense by 1 stage in Trainer Battles.
  • Zap Cannon: 100% chance to lower the opponent's Attack by 1 stage in Trainer Battles.
  • Scald: Energy cost decreased from 60 to 50 and 30% chance to lower the opponent's Attack by 1 stage in Trainer Battles.
  • Feather Dance: Energy cost increased from 45 to 50 in Trainer Battles.
  • Megahorn: Base power increased from 100 to 110 in Trainer Battles.
